I am a fortunate owner of Kolb and I backed him up with Rothesburger. So, I need a QB this week. I currently picked up D. Anderson to fill in. Vick was taken by an owner just to get a trade value out of me so I am trying to return the favor by coming out on top. Standard scoring league with 6 pts per PATD. We start 2RB and 2 WR

roster
RB's - J. Charles, R. Mathews, B. Wells, M barber, D. Brown
Wr's - A. Johnson, Wes Welker, Sims Walker, J. Knox, Jacoby Jones

Heres the offer:

My Wells/ Sims walker for his S. Greene/ Vick

My thinking is that I can by low on Greene and I dont 'really' need sims-walker. Vick is a 1-2 week replacement, but upgrading with Greene as my #3 is nice. I am not worried about LT too much in the long run and this is a 3 man keeper league. Your thoughts? Or should I just roll with D. Anderson this week and hope for the best with Kolb?

i think its close to a wash. vicks value will be very minimal, especially once kold returns. anderson isn't a bad qb, just inconsistent, but he has a ton of weapons. however, i would definately consider greene an upgrade over wells, and MSW is a guy i never put too much stock into. especially with a qb who some weeks will only pass for 100 yds. i think greene is the best player in the deal, beanie the 2nd best. both are in some sort of time share. but beanie shares time with another young rb. greene shares time with an old vet. i say hold where you are, try and sell beanie and MSW when they have more value. you would be buying low on greene, but beanie may as well produce just as good
